Transaction 99ef60133780b14762d639f91b379b5b287eb0aaf1b177c0a36fba5f6a1b3fad
1 Input
1 Output
-
99ef60133780b14762d639f91b379b5b287eb0aaf1b177c0a36fba5f6a1b3fad:0
- value
- 2957501
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b10cad3b9394851893a72821ef436808aff7382 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DgK3QyiMLa5exPsDUsnh9imByYrXAUfL7